Questions & Answers

What companies run services between Pittsburgh, PA, USA and Valhalla, NY, USA?

Greyhound USA operates a bus from Pittsburgh Intermodal Station to Port Authority Bus Terminal every 4 hours. Tickets cost $50–150 and the journey takes 7h 10m. Megabus also services this route once daily. Alternatively, you can take a train from Pittsburgh Amtrak Station to Valhalla via Ny Moynihan Train Hall At Penn Station, 42 St-Times Square, Grand Central-42 St, and Grand Central Terminal in around 10h 44m.
